Summary
The Leasing Consultant provides tours, completes the leasing process with prospective residents, executes marketing strategies for the community and maintains positive resident relations. Essential Duties and Responsibilities
Interviews prospective residents and records information to ascertain needs and qualifications. Accompanies prospects to model/vacant apartments and discusses size and layout of rooms, available amenities and terms of lease. Ensures consistent follow‑up with prospects. Processes application for approval in compliance with policies and procedures. May be responsible for processing lease renewals. Schedules move‑ins and completes all lease paperwork with prospect. Walks all move‑ins prior to the move‑in date to ensure readiness. Follow up with new residents after move‑in. Inspects condition of premises periodically and arranges for necessary maintenance. Plans and coordinates resident events. Courteous, efficient handling of resident requests and complaints. Assists with all marketing duties including preparation of market surveys. Assists with sending out all resident notices. Weekend work may be required. Adheres to all company policies including but not limited to safety and Fair Housing. Other job duties as assigned. Qualifications and Skills
One year experience as a leasing professional is preferred. Up to one year of related experience or training. An equivalent combination of education and experience may be acceptable. Experience with virtual and in-person community tours is preferred. Working knowledge of property management platforms (i.e. Yardi, Entrata, Yieldstar, CRM) preferred. Marketing skills with the ability to execute a property marketing plan through outside marketing, social media and resident functions. Familiarity with the local market preferred. Excellent communication (verbal and written), relationship-building and customer service skills. A valid driver's license and automobile insurance may be required. Environmental and Physical Demands
